Chip Kelly has denied reports that the Philadelphia Eagles had been trying to trade up for Marcus Mariota in the days leading up to the draft.

The Eagles were reportedly offering picks, along with defensive end Fletcher Cox, quarterback Sam Bradford, linebacker Mychal Kendricks, guard Evan Mathis and cornerback Brandon Boykin.

“I didn’t think it was going to happen, and it didn’t happen,” Kelly said, via Reuben Frank of CSN Philly. “It was a really steep price.”

The Eagles instead stayed at No. 20 and picked Nelson Agholor.
